desktop_capture: Fix Xrandr / Xrender order

Since Xrandr depends on Xrender, it needs to be explicitely listed before, otherwise linkers may not find the Xrender symbols.

Bug: None
Change-Id: Ifb1e82f63e1fc1645979c14b65e3beab06637cb8
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/375428
Reviewed-by: Harald Alvestrand <hta@webrtc.org>
Auto-Submit: Florent Castelli SE <fcastelli@nvidia.com>
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org>
Commit-Queue: Harald Alvestrand <hta@webrtc.org>
Cr-Commit-Position: refs/heads/main@{#43808}
This commit is contained in:
Florent Castelli 2025-01-27 16:26:03 +01:00 committed by WebRTC LUCI CQ
parent 26617bef59
commit bea44590f6

View File

@ -408,8 +408,11 @@ rtc_library("desktop_capture") {
"Xdamage", "Xdamage",
"Xext", "Xext",
"Xfixes", "Xfixes",
"Xrender",
# Xrandr depends on Xrender and needs to be listed before its dependency.
"Xrandr", "Xrandr",
"Xrender",
"Xtst", "Xtst",
] ]
} }